WebThe homestead of a family or single adult is protected from forced sale except in cases of purchase money, taxes (both ad valorem and federal tax liens against both spouses), owelty of partition (divorce), home improvement loans, home equity loans, reverse mortgages, liens predating the establishment of homestead, refinance loans, or the … Web6 dec. 2024 · The homestead exemption is a legal provision that can help minimize property tax, protect a home from bankruptcy, or provide certain rights to … Web1 jun. 2024 · When it comes to real estate serving as a homestead, Florida’s spousal protections are even stronger.
